This Special Issue examines the rapidly converging fields of radiation science, biomedical engineering, and emerging therapeutic technologies. It focuses on how ionizing and non-ionizing radiation interact with biological systems across molecular, cellular, and tissue levels, revealing mechanisms that guide diagnosis, treatment, and material innovation. Featured contributions explore radiation-responsive materials, advanced imaging systems, and computational models that predict energy deposition and cellular stress. Emphasis is placed on engineering strategies that improve therapeutic precision, minimize off-target effects, and integrate photonic, magnetic, and radiative modalities. Collectively, these studies highlight interdisciplinary advances shaping the future of radiation medicine and engineered interventions.

Journal Scope
Science Act is a multidisciplinary journal that focuses on advancing scientific knowledge across various fields. It publishes original research, reviews, and articles that explore diverse areas of science, including biology, chemistry, physics, engineering, and environmental sciences. The journal employs a rigorous peer-review process, ensuring the quality and credibility of the content it publishes. This process fosters the validation of research findings and encourages scholarly dialogue. By bridging the gap between different scientific disciplines, Science Act serves as a platform for collaboration, innovation, and the dissemination of groundbreaking discoveries that address global challenges.
